TechnipFMC
Aberdeen, Aberdeenshire - Scotland

Senior Rigid Pipeline Engineer
10.2010 - 03.2022

Job overview

  • Managing offshore projects through preparing a detailed engineering design of the offshore rigid pipelines following the standard codes (DNV,API and ASME) and ensure compliance with specified design rules and procedures
  • Preparing project budget planning (CTRs)
  • Solve various engineering problems related to pipelines during the design, manufacturing, installation and operation phase
  • Pipelines design optimisation to reduce project cost and adhere to project requirements to ensure that conceptual and detailed designs are properly worked through performing different FE analysis including pipelines reel-ability pipelines, coating systems design, spooling assessment using Abaqus and Orcaflex.
  • Evaluate and define the pipe material properties based on pipe manufactures testing reports (MTRs) to check the pipes suitability for reeling, carry out pipeline risk assessments during installation, check various engineering drawings, pipeline mechanical design including pipeline stress/strain calculations, wall thickness and pipe ovality calculations.
  • Determine the pipe residual ovality post bending cycles on the reel-lay vessel where the cyclic bending of pipe to plastic strain induces permanent deformation in the pipe section which influences the pipe integrity and leads to pipe collapse on the seabed.
  • Provide quality control checks of all pipeline engineering documents and drawings.
  • Preform the reelability assessment (mismatch between pipe joints) of different sizes of single, clad pipelines and Pipe in Pipe (PiP) systems installed using Technip reel-lay vessels
  • Perform FE analysis on other subsea tools/structures such as Bulkheads, Pawnhead/Followers to assess the integrity and suitability for reeling using Abaqus software
  • Performing spooling and installation analysis of the pipelines when it is laid on the seabed and through in-service
  • Writing engineering reports and technical notes for the projects details the outcome from the analysis and give the recommendations,
  • Writing technical guide reports for offshore pipelines to disseminate the knowledge across the company groups and contribute to consolidation of the projects
  • Doing the self-check (QA) of reports and for other engineers in the group and externally
  • Arrange meetings, preparing presentations to project management teams and clients.
  • Evaluate and define the pipe material properties based on pipe manufactures testing reports (MTRs) to check the pipes suitability for reeling andcarry out pipeline risk assessments during installation.
  • Pipelines, buckle arrestors integrity testing for reelability and suitability for installation
